IT Recruiter Jobs in USA with Visa Sponsorship
IT Recruiter roles are sponsored under the H-1B visa as a specialty occupation, requiring a bachelor's degree in human resources, business, or a related field. Employers across staffing agencies and tech firms regularly sponsor, making this a viable path for international candidates with sourcing and technical hiring experience. How to Get Visa Sponsorship as an IT Recruiter
Emphasize technical domain knowledge
Hiring managers want IT recruiters who understand what they're sourcing for. Demonstrate familiarity with software engineering roles, cloud platforms, and DevOps terminology. This separates you from generalist recruiters and strengthens your specialty occupation case with USCIS.
Target staffing firms with H-1B track records
Large IT staffing agencies sponsor H-1B visas regularly and have established legal infrastructure for petitions. Prioritize employers with documented sponsorship history over smaller boutique firms that may lack the resources or willingness to sponsor international hires.
Align your degree to the role description
H-1B approval for IT Recruiter roles depends on demonstrating specialty occupation status. A degree in human resources, business administration, or information systems strengthens your petition. Ensure your job offer specifically requires a degree in a relevant field.
Negotiate sponsorship before accepting offers
Confirm H-1B sponsorship willingness during early interviews, not after receiving an offer. Ask whether the company has sponsored before, who manages the process internally, and what timeline they expect. Late-stage surprises create unnecessary delays and stress.
Build a metrics-driven resume
Quantify your recruiting impact with time-to-fill rates, placement volumes, and retention outcomes. USCIS and hiring managers both respond to evidence of professional performance. Concrete numbers demonstrate the specialized nature of your work and justify the sponsorship investment.

Does an IT Recruiter qualify for H-1B visa sponsorship?
Yes, IT Recruiter roles can qualify as specialty occupations under the H-1B, but approval is not guaranteed. USCIS evaluates whether the position normally requires a bachelor's degree in a specific field. Job descriptions that require a degree in human resources, business, or information systems are better positioned than vague postings listing any degree as acceptable.
What degree do I need for an IT Recruiter H-1B petition?
A bachelor's degree in human resources, business administration, organizational psychology, or information systems is most commonly accepted. The degree must relate specifically to the duties of the role. Degrees in unrelated fields can weaken a petition unless supported by specialized coursework or substantial professional experience in technical recruitment.
Are IT Recruiter H-1B petitions commonly approved or denied?
IT Recruiter petitions face above-average scrutiny because USCIS has historically questioned whether recruiting constitutes a specialty occupation. Approval rates improve significantly when the job description emphasizes technical complexity, requires a specific degree field, and is filed by an employer with prior H-1B approval history. Working with experienced immigration counsel on the petition language matters considerably here.
Which types of employers are most likely to sponsor IT Recruiters?
Large IT staffing firms, enterprise technology companies with internal talent acquisition teams, and consulting firms are the most consistent sponsors. Smaller agencies rarely have the legal infrastructure or budget for H-1B petitions. Can I transfer my H-1B to a new IT Recruiter role at a different company?
Yes, H-1B portability allows you to transfer your visa to a new employer once your original petition has been approved and you have maintained valid status. The new employer must file an H-1B transfer petition before your start date. You can begin working for the new company as soon as the transfer petition is filed, without waiting for final approval.
What is the prevailing wage requirement for sponsored IT Recruiter jobs?
U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
